암호화 및 복호화 알고리즘(EncryptDecryptCommand)
Last updated
Last updated
서버가 다른 소프트웨어와 연결되면 반환 값을 암호화해야 하는 경우가 많은데 이 플러그인은 MD5 및 Base64와 같은 다양한 암호화 요구 사항을 완벽하게 해결할 수 있습니다.
이 플러그인은 서버단 명령에서만 사용할 수 있습니다.
버전에 맞는 플러그인을 다운로드 합니다.
플러그인을 다운로드합니다.
Forguncy Builder에서 설치하고 Forguncy Builder를 다시 실행합니다.
서버단 명령에서 아래와 같이 설정합니다.
3-1. 서버단 명령 실행 창에서 파라미터를 설정합니다.
3-2. 서버단 명령 실행 창에서 반환값을 설정합니다.
3-3. 서버단 명령 실행 창에서 명령을 다음과 같이 설정합니다.
- 명령 선택 : MD5 암호화
- Source : SourceCode
- 알고리즘 : 소문자 16 (대문자 16, 소문자 16, 대문자 32, 소문자 32 총 4가지 암호화 방법 제공)
- 결과를 파라미터로 반환 : Result
4. 실행하면 아래와 같이 암호화 코드를 반환합니다.
사용자 비밀번호, 요청 매개변수, 파일 확인 등
16비트 암호화는 32비트 MD5 해시에서 중간 16비트를 추출하는 것으로, 32비트 암호화에 비해 16비트 암호화는 해독하기가 더 어렵습니다. 32비트를 크랙할 필요가 없으며 암호화 후 바로 비교할 수 있습니다.
사용 방법은 기본적으로 MD5와 동일합니다. 사용법은 기본적으로 MD5와 동일하지만 Base64는 암호화 뿐만 아니라 복호화도 지원한다는 차이점이 있습니다.
HMAC 암호화 알고리즘은 암호화된 해시 기능과 공유 키를 기반으로 하는 보안 메시지 인증 프로토콜입니다.
HMAC 암호화 알고리즘은 메시지 무결성을 위한 키 기반 검증 방식이며 보안은 Hash 암호화 알고리즘을 기반으로 하며 전송 중 데이터 가로채기 및 변조를 효과적으로 방지하고 데이터의 무결성, 신뢰성 및 보안을 유지합니다.
양 당사자가 키를 공유하고, 알고리즘에 동의하고, 메시지에 대해 해시 연산을 수행하여 고정 길이 인증 코드를 형성해야 합니다.
통신의 양 당사자는 인증 코드를 확인하여 메시지의 유효성을 결정합니다.
HMAC 암호화 알고리즘은 암호화, 전자 서명, 메시지 확인 등에 사용할 수 있습니다.
Source
입력 값
일반 텍스트 문자열 전달
Secret
입력 값
사용자 지정 키 전달
알고리즘
입력 값
암호화 방법 선택(HMACSHA1, HMACSHA256, HMACSHA512, HMACMD5),
결과를 파라미터로 반환
출력 값
암호화된 암호문을 새 매개변수에 전달